BOE Chairman Chen Yanshun Holds High-Level Meeting with Samsung Electronics’ VD Division — Signs of Improving Relations

BOE Chairman Chen Yanshun met with senior executives from Samsung Electronics’ Video Display (VD) division on June 30, according to industry sources. The meeting was attended by Chen and other top BOE executives, and was reportedly held to explore ways to improve relations and seek potential strategic cooperation between the two companies.

BOE is China’s largest display manufacturer, producing large-size LCD and OLED panels. The company maintains a strong presence in the domestic TV and IT display markets and supplies products to global clients. Samsung Electronics’ VD division, which oversees its TV business, has maintained the No.1 position in the global TV market for several years, making stable panel procurement a key strategic focus.

The meeting was part of a formal consultation between the two companies and is seen as a move to reset relations that have been relatively distant in recent years. Specific details or outcomes of the discussion were not disclosed.

Industry observers note that the direct involvement of Chairman Chen highlights BOE’s strong interest in restoring its business ties with Samsung Electronics. With Samsung also reviewing and restructuring its display supply chain, this meeting could mark an inflection point in the relationship between the two firms.
